Where is the horn location of the Mercedes-Benz S350 Business Edition?

The horn of the Mercedes-Benz S350 Business Edition is installed under the bumper. Here is a brief introduction to the Mercedes-Benz S350: The Mercedes-Benz S350 is produced by the German Daimler-Benz company. The most significant improvement in the 2004 new-generation S350 is the brand-new V6 engine from Mercedes-Benz, which increases the output power by 12.5% compared to the previous generation V6 engine, reaching 180Kw (245Hp); the torque is increased by 13%, reaching 350Nm at 3000rpm. Standard configuration introduction: The standard configuration of the S350 includes: automatic climate control system with dust and activated carbon filters, push-button ignition, front passenger and rear outer passenger seat belt tensioners with force limiters, COMAND control and display system, cruise control with electronic speed limit function and variable speed limiter, electrically adjustable steering column with easy-entry function, electric seats with lumbar support, headlight delay-off function, speed-sensitive variable power steering, and PRE-SAFE system.

As a veteran driver with over 20 years of experience, I remember that the horn location for the Mercedes-Benz S350 Business Edition is generally at the front part of the engine compartment. To be specific, after opening the hood, you can find it behind the radiator or on the bracket inside the bumper. It's usually hidden quite discreetly, possibly covered by a protective panel. Once when my own horn stopped working, I spent some time locating it and discovered it was due to water ingress causing poor contact. The horn is positioned there primarily for long-distance sound propagation and to be waterproof and shockproof. However, while driving, it's important to check it regularly—don't wait until it fails in an emergency to notice. During maintenance, it's advisable to operate carefully when the engine is cold to avoid damaging other electronic components—safety first. If you're really unsure about the location, refer to the vehicle manual for detailed diagrams. With cars, paying attention to details in daily use can save a lot of trouble.

Should Turn Signals Be Used When Exiting the Garage in Subject 2?

When performing reverse parking or exiting the garage in Subject 2 of the driving test, turn signals are not required. There are a total of 6 instances in Subject 2 where turn signals must be used, which are: 1. Turn on the left turn signal when starting the vehicle; 2. Turn on the left turn signal when starting on a slope; 3. Use the right turn signal when passing the parallel parking spot and preparing to park within 30 cm of the side line before reversing; 4. Turn on the left turn signal before shifting into reverse gear during parallel parking, as the steering wheel will be turned fully to the right, causing the front of the car to shift left during reversing; 5. Shift into drive gear and turn on the left turn signal before exiting the parallel parking spot, and turn it off promptly after exiting; 6. Turn on the left turn signal when entering the sharp turn area and turn it off promptly after completing the turn. Penalties for incorrect use of turn signals are as follows: - Failing to use or incorrectly using turn signals before starting, turning, changing lanes, overtaking, or parking results in a deduction of 10 points. - Turning the steering wheel within less than 3 seconds of activating the turn signal before starting, turning, changing lanes, overtaking, or parking results in a deduction of 10 points. Subject 2 has a total score of 100 points, with evaluation criteria for failing, deducting 20 points, deducting 10 points, or deducting 5 points. The test is considered passed under the following conditions: ① For large passenger vehicles, tractors, city buses, medium passenger vehicles, and large trucks, a score of 90 or above is required; ② For other vehicle types, a score of 80 or above is required. The test items for small vehicles (C1, C2) include reverse parking, parallel parking, slope parking and starting (canceled for C2), sharp turns, and S-curves (commonly known as the "S-bend")—five mandatory items (some regions include a sixth item: highway toll card collection). The test items for large vehicles (A1, A2, A3, B1, B2) include pole parking, slope parking and starting, parallel parking, single-plank bridge crossing, S-curves, sharp turns, narrow gate passing, continuous obstacle passing, bumpy road driving, narrow road U-turns, as well as simulated highway driving, continuous sharp mountain turns, tunnels, rain (fog) conditions, slippery roads, and emergency handling.

What is Rollback?

Rollback refers to coasting in neutral or with the clutch disengaged. It also describes the phenomenon where a vehicle moves backward when starting on a slope due to improper coordination between the throttle and clutch, which is also called rollback. Coasting in neutral reduces the vehicle's braking force, increasing the risk of rear-end collisions. Related extended information is as follows: Causes of rollback: It occurs when the clutch engagement point is not sufficiently released (the clutch is released too low) or when the throttle is not applied (the engine idle speed is too low to propel the vehicle) while releasing the handbrake. There are two causes of stalling: First, it happens when braking abruptly or releasing the clutch too quickly after rollback occurs. Second, it occurs when the clutch is released beyond the engagement point while the handbrake is still engaged during startup.

What is the tire pressure reset method for the Lexus ES200?

The tire pressure reset method for the Lexus ES200 is: after turning off the engine, turn on the ignition switch power, press and hold the reset button until the tire pressure monitoring light on the dashboard flashes three times, then release the button. Tire pressure refers to the air pressure inside the tire, and unstable tire pressure will reduce the tire's service life. Taking the 2020 Lexus ES200 as an example, its body structure is a 4-door, 5-seat sedan with the following dimensions: length 4975mm, width 1866mm, height 1447mm, wheelbase 2870mm, front track 1595mm, rear track 1612mm, fuel tank capacity 60.6L, trunk capacity 454L, and curb weight 1610kg.

What is the normal battery voltage for the Envision?

The normal battery voltage for the Envision is 12V. The functions of the battery are: 1. To supply power to the engine starting system, ignition system, and the vehicle; 2. To provide power to the vehicle's electrical equipment when the engine is off or at low idle; 3. To mitigate impact voltage in the electrical system and protect the vehicle's electronic devices. Battery maintenance methods include: 1. Avoid overusing the battery; 2. Regularly clean the positive and negative terminals of the battery; 3. Periodically check the vent holes on non-maintenance-free battery covers to prevent clogging; 4. Avoid low battery water levels; 5. When parking for an extended period, start the vehicle once a week to charge the battery.

How to Drive a CVT Car?

Driving methods for a CVT car are as follows: 1. Starting: Press the brake, shift into N gear to start, after starting is completed shift into D gear, release the brake, and press the accelerator to complete the start; 2. Parking: Release the accelerator, then press the brake to stop, wait until the car comes to a complete stop, shift the gear from D to N, pull the handbrake, and then turn off the P gear to complete the shutdown. A CVT car does not have specific gears, it is also a type of automatic transmission, but the change in speed ratio is different from the gear shifting process of an automatic transmission, it is continuous, thus the power transmission is continuous and smooth.
